How Common Is The Last Name Palmadera?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 453,475th most widespread surname internationally. It is borne by approximately 1 in 9,742,708 people. This surname is primarily found in The Americas, where 100 percent of Palmadera reside; 100 percent reside in South America and 100 percent reside in Andean South America.
This surname is most commonly occurring in Peru, where it is held by 746 people, or 1 in 42,606. In Peru Palmadera is mostly found in: Áncash Region, where 84 percent live, Lima Province, where 12 percent live and Lima Region, where 3 percent live. Not including Peru it is found in 2 countries. It is also found in Chile, where 0 percent live and The United States, where 0 percent live.
